    Safety Instructions & Warnings

  • Neodymium magnets are extremely powerful. Keep them away from children and pets to avoid pinching injuries or accidental ingestion.
  • Use with caution. Strong magnets may snap together suddenly and cause pinching of fingers, hands or other body parts. Always handle slowly and carefully.
  • Do not place magnets near pacemakers, defibrillators or other medical devices, as they may interfere with normal operation.
  • Keep magnets away from electronic devices, including credit cards, mobile phones, watches, hard drives and other magnetic-sensitive products.
  • Avoid dropping or striking magnets. They are brittle and may crack, chip or shatter under impact.
  • Do not attempt to machine, drill or modify magnets unless you have proper tools and experience, as this may cause breakage or fire.
  • If swallowed or inhaled, seek medical attention immediately.
